Overview

Situated on the mouth of the Seine River, Le Havre is not only a bustling port city but also a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Known for its modernist architecture, Le Havre underwent a major transformation after being heavily bombed during World War II. Today, the city stands as a testament to resilience and innovation, with its unique urban design and harmonious blend of old and new. Museums and Art Galleries

Le Havre is a haven for art lovers and history buffs, with its impressive collection of museums and art galleries. Visit the Musée d’Art Moderne André Malraux (MuMa) and admire its extensive collection of Impressionist masterpieces. Explore the Musée Maison de l’Armateur and step back in time to the 18th century, where you can learn about the city’s maritime history. Don’t miss the Musée du Vieux Havre, which showcases Le Havre’s heritage through its fascinating exhibits.

Historical Sites

Le Havre is steeped in history, and there are numerous historical sites waiting to be discovered. Visit the Saint-Joseph Church, an architectural marvel known for its stunning stained glass windows. Explore the Maison de l’Armateur, a beautifully restored 18th-century shipowner’s house that provides a glimpse into Le Havre’s past. Take a stroll through the St. Joseph Residential District to admire the iconic modernist architecture that defines the city.
